Battery capacity is a crucial feature that determines how long the Oculus Quest 2 can run on an extended battery. It is measured in milliampere-hours (mAh). Higher capacity provides longer usage time. For example, a battery with 10,000 mAh may offer several additional hours of gameplay compared to a smaller 5,000 mAh unit. -
Charging Speed:
Charging speed refers to how quickly the battery can be recharged. Fast charging technology can significantly reduce downtime. Many extended batteries advertise a quick charge feature, allowing users to get back to gaming sooner. An extended battery that supports USB Power Delivery (PD) can often achieve quicker charge times. -
Weight and Design:
Weight and design impact the portability and comfort of using the Oculus Quest 2 while connected to an extended battery. Lighter batteries are often preferred for extended sessions, while ergonomic designs reduce strain on the user. A bulky battery can alter the headset’s balance, affecting overall user comfort. -
Compatibility:
Compatibility ensures the extended battery works seamlessly with the Oculus Quest 2. Look for batteries specifically labeled as compatible with this model. Mismatches may lead to inadequate power supply or even device damage. -
Cable Length:
Cable length is important for flexibility during use. A longer cable allows greater freedom of movement while gaming. Alternatively, a shorter cable may be suitable for more stationary setups. Consider your gaming habits when assessing cable length. -

Using an external battery pack: An external battery pack can significantly increase the playtime of the Oculus Quest 2. Many users report at least 6 to 10 additional hours of usage when they connect a high-capacity power bank to the headset. Choose a lightweight battery pack that can be conveniently attached to the headset for comfort.
Managing settings: Adjusting performance settings can help extend the battery’s life and improve the overall experience. Lowering the graphics settings and reducing the refresh rate can lead to longer sessions. Users can also disable unnecessary apps running in the background, which may drain battery life.
Adjusting playtime: Planning sessions strategically can prevent running out of battery unexpectedly. Many players recommend taking short breaks and allowing the headset to rest. Monitoring battery levels during gameplay helps in maintaining an optimal experience.
Comfort improvements: Attaching an external battery pack can create a more balanced weight distribution on the headset, improving comfort during longer gaming sessions. This adjustment can result in fewer distractions and better immersion in virtual environments.
